Abstract

本发明属于保健食品深加工技术领域,具体公开了一种高品质铁皮石斛及其采用变温压差膨化干燥方法。本发明提供的铁皮石斛干燥方法步骤如下,采用新鲜铁皮石斛切段后用糖水浸泡处理,经过热风干燥箱进行预干燥处理,最后进行变温压差膨化干燥。本发明的铁皮石斛干品含水量低,多糖含量和蛋白质含量较高,酥脆性佳,口感良好,无添加剂,可直接食用,易于携带储存;采用变温压差膨化干燥铁皮石斛的方法最大程度的保留了原有新鲜铁皮石斛的营养成分,生产周期短且产量高,生产成本低。The invention belongs to the technical field of deep processing of health food, and specifically discloses a high-quality Dendrobium officinale and a method for puffing and drying using variable temperature and pressure difference. The drying method for Dendrobium officinale provided by the present invention has the following steps: fresh Dendrobium officinale is cut into sections, soaked in sugar water, pre-dried in a hot air drying box, and finally puffed and dried by variable temperature and pressure difference. The dried Dendrobium officinale product of the invention has low water content, high polysaccharide content and high protein content, good crispness, good taste, no additives, can be directly eaten, and is easy to carry and store; the method of puffing and drying Dendrobium officinale by changing temperature and pressure difference maximizes the The nutrient components of the original fresh Dendrobium candidum are retained, the production cycle is short, the yield is high, and the production cost is low.

Description

High-quality dendrobium officinale and variable-temperature differential pressure puffing drying method thereof
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of deep processing of health-care food, and particularly relates to high-quality dendrobium officinale and a variable-temperature differential-pressure puffing drying method thereof.
Background
Dendrobium officinale is an orchid family herbaceous plant and contains effective components such as dendrobium polysaccharide, dendrobine and total amino acids. Can improve the immunity of human body, enhance the memory, supplement consumptive disease of five internal organs, delay senility, inhibit tumor, improve the nutrition of cardiac muscle, dredge cardiovascular and cerebrovascular vessels, reduce heart fire, have obvious effect on radiotherapy and excessive smoking and drinking, and is a very good health food. In recent years, with the improvement of living standard of people, the dendrobium officinale with health care function is more and more popular. However, the fresh dendrobium officinale contains 80-95% of water, is easy to rot and inconvenient to store and transport, and is easy to cause lost sales and waste. However, the conventional hot air drying method damages effective components due to long-time high-temperature drying, and the production time is long. Modern freeze-drying activities retain ingredients well but with low yields and high costs. Meanwhile, the traditional dried dendrobium officinale has poor taste and cannot be directly eaten.

The invention provides a variable-temperature differential pressure puffing drying method for dendrobium officinale, which comprises the following steps:
1) selecting raw materials: selecting fresh, healthy and clean dendrobium officinale stems as raw materials;
2) pretreatment of raw materials: cutting the dendrobium officinale stems in the step 1) into small sections, soaking the small sections in a sucrose aqueous solution, taking out and draining the small sections for later use;
3) pre-drying raw materials:
pre-drying the pretreated dendrobium officinale obtained in the step 2) by using a hot air drying oven to ensure that the water content of the dendrobium officinale is 20-40%, and then putting the dendrobium officinale into a refrigerator for softening for later use;
4) puffing and drying at variable temperature and pressure difference:
placing the Dendrobium officinale processed in step 3) into a puffing tank, raising the puffing temperature in the tank to 60-80 ℃, raising the air pressure in the tank to 0.1-0.2Mpa, and standing for puffing for 20-40 min; opening a pressure release valve to enable the dendrobium officinale to be in a vacuum state instantly, reducing the evacuation temperature to 60 ℃, and keeping the evacuation time at the temperature for 1-2 h; and (5) closing the valve, cooling to normal temperature, recovering the internal air pressure to the normal pressure state after the product is shaped, taking out the product, and storing.
With reference to the second aspect, in one possible implementation manner, the dendrobium officinale stem in the step 2) is cut into small segments with the length of 4-6mm, and the ratio of material to liquid is 1: 4-1: 6kg/l of the mixture is placed in a 5-15% sucrose aqueous solution for soaking for 0.5-1 h.
With reference to the second aspect, in one possible embodiment, the dendrobium officinale stem is cut into small segments with the length of 5mm, and the ratio of material to liquid is 1: 5kg/l of the mixture is placed in a 10% sucrose aqueous solution for soaking for 0.5 h.
With reference to the second aspect, in one possible embodiment, the moisture content of dendrobium officinale in the step 3) is 30%.
With reference to the second aspect, in one possible embodiment, the moisture content of dendrobium officinale in the step 3) is 40%.
In combination with the second aspect, in one possible embodiment, the temperature of the pre-drying treatment in the step 3) is 60 to 80 ℃; the temperature in the refrigerator is 4 ℃; the softening time is 12 h.
In a possible embodiment, in combination with the second aspect, the temperature of the in-tank puffing in the step 4) is 80 ℃, and the puffing time is 30 min.
In a possible embodiment, in combination with the second aspect, the evacuation temperature in step 4) is 60 ℃ and the evacuation time is 2 h.

Example 1
1) Selecting raw materials: selecting fresh, healthy and clean dendrobium officinale stems as raw materials;
2) pretreatment of raw materials: cutting the dendrobium officinale stems in the step 1) into small sections with the length of 5mm, wherein the material-liquid ratio is 1: 5kg/l of the mixture is placed in a 10% sucrose aqueous solution for soaking for 0.5h, and then the mixture is taken out and drained for standby.
3) Pre-drying raw materials:
pre-drying the dendrobium officinale pretreated in the step 2) at 60 ℃ by using a hot air drying oven to ensure that the water content of the dendrobium officinale is 40%, and then putting the dendrobium officinale into a refrigerator at 4 ℃ to soften for 12 hours for later use.
4) Puffing and drying at variable temperature and pressure difference:
placing the Dendrobium officinale processed in the step 3) into a puffing tank, raising the puffing temperature in the tank to 80 ℃, raising the air pressure in the tank to 0.1-0.2Mpa, and standing for puffing for 30 min; opening a pressure release valve to enable the dendrobium officinale to be in a vacuum state instantly, reducing the evacuation temperature to 60 ℃, and keeping the evacuation time at the temperature for 1 h; and (5) closing the valve, cooling to normal temperature, recovering the internal air pressure to the normal pressure state after the product is shaped, taking out the product, and storing.
The dendrobium officinale obtained by the embodiment has the water content of 6.020%, the polysaccharide content of 21.067% and the protein content of 4.960%.
Example 2
1) Selecting raw materials: selecting fresh, healthy and clean dendrobium officinale stems as raw materials;
2) pretreatment of raw materials: cutting the dendrobium officinale stems in the step 1) into small sections with the length of 6mm, wherein the material-liquid ratio is 1: 4kg/l of the mixture is placed in a 15% sucrose aqueous solution to be soaked for 0.8h, and then the mixture is taken out and drained for standby.
3) Pre-drying raw materials:
pre-drying the dendrobium officinale pretreated in the step 2) at 70 ℃ by using a hot air drying oven to ensure that the water content of the dendrobium officinale is 30%, and then putting the dendrobium officinale into a refrigerator at 4 ℃ to soften for 12 hours for later use.
4) Puffing and drying at variable temperature and pressure difference:
placing the Dendrobium officinale processed in the step 3) into a puffing tank, raising the puffing temperature in the tank to 80 ℃, raising the air pressure in the tank to 0.1-0.2Mpa, and standing for puffing for 20 min; opening a pressure release valve to enable the dendrobium officinale to be in a vacuum state instantly, reducing the evacuation temperature to 60 ℃, and keeping the evacuation time at the temperature for 1.5 h; and (5) closing the valve, cooling to normal temperature, recovering the internal air pressure to the normal pressure state after the product is shaped, taking out the product, and storing.
The dendrobium officinale obtained by the embodiment has the water content of 7.020%, the polysaccharide content of 15.250% and the protein content of 4.010%.
Example 3
1) Selecting raw materials: selecting fresh, healthy and clean dendrobium officinale stems as raw materials;
2) pretreatment of raw materials: cutting the dendrobium officinale stems in the step 1) into small sections with the length of 4mm, wherein the material-liquid ratio is 1: soaking 6kg/l in 5% sucrose water solution for 1h, taking out, and draining for later use.
3) Pre-drying raw materials:
pre-drying the dendrobium officinale pretreated in the step 2) at 80 ℃ by using a hot air drying oven to ensure that the water content of the dendrobium officinale is 20%, and then putting the dendrobium officinale into a refrigerator at 4 ℃ to soften for 12 hours for later use.
4) Puffing and drying at variable temperature and pressure difference:
placing the Dendrobium officinale processed in the step 3) into a puffing tank, raising the puffing temperature in the tank to 80 ℃, raising the air pressure in the tank to 0.1-0.2Mpa, and standing for puffing for 40 min; opening a pressure release valve to enable the dendrobium officinale to be in a vacuum state instantly, reducing the evacuation temperature to 60 ℃, and keeping the evacuation time at the temperature for 2 hours; and (5) closing the valve, cooling to normal temperature, recovering the internal air pressure to the normal pressure state after the product is shaped, taking out the product, and storing.
The dendrobium officinale obtained in the embodiment has the water content of 6.200%, the polysaccharide content of 21.210% and the protein content of 4.740%.

from the above table 1, it is known that the pre-drying moisture content of the dendrobium officinale is too low, the protein content is obviously reduced, and the pre-drying moisture content is too high, the polysaccharide content is obviously reduced; the puffing temperature is too low, the polysaccharide content is obviously reduced, the puffing temperature is too high, and the polysaccharide content and the protein are both obviously reduced; the puffing time is too long, the polysaccharide content is obviously reduced, and the protein content has a tendency of reduction; the puffing time is too short, and the polysaccharide content and the protein content both tend to be reduced; the evacuation time is too long or too short, and both the polysaccharide content and the protein content tend to decrease.
Therefore, the dendrobium officinale drying method provided by the invention optimizes the parameter value ranges of 4 investigation factors through experiments as follows: predrying with water content of 20-40%, puffing at 60-80 deg.C in a jar for 20-40min, and evacuating for 1-2 hr.
